Ive kept both, the rift s is far better and looks better than the quest 2 over link for racing sims, this will probably change with future updates for the quest 2. Still prefer the rift s when sitting down at my sims rig for racing sims.
The quest 2 is excellent over wifi for games like half life alyx, beat saber etc. I know its an expense but they both have their place.
